The Guardians' Strategic Move: Unlocking Potential Behind the Plate

In a move that has caught the attention of baseball enthusiasts, the Cleveland Guardians have acquired catcher Patrick Bailey from the San Francisco Giants. This trade, as reported by ESPN's Jeff Passan, involves a promising left-handed pitching prospect, Matt Wilkinson, and a valuable draft pick, the 29th overall selection in the 2026 draft.
